The Silent Trigger: It’s Not Always About Your Balance

You placed a bet. It won. Your account shows available cash. So why does clicking “Withdraw” lead to an error—or worse, radio silence?

The culprit is rarely technical failure. FanDuel’s system auto-blocks withdrawals based on risk flags, not just funds availability. These include:

  • Mismatched personal details (even a typo in your ZIP code)
  • Unverified ID or proof of address
  • Bonus wagering non-compliance
  • Suspicious deposit/withdrawal patterns (e.g., rapid cycling)

Unlike banks, FanDuel doesn’t notify you before blocking access. You only discover the issue when attempting to cash out. That’s by design: anti-fraud protocols prioritize security over user convenience.

Payment Method Pitfalls: Why Your Card or PayPal Fails

Not all withdrawal options behave the same. FanDuel supports:

  • Play+ Card (instant, but max $10k/day)
  • Bank Transfer (ACH) (3–5 business days)
  • PayPal (24–48 hours, but restricted in some states)
  • Check by Mail (7–14 days, $2.50 fee)

But here’s what they don’t advertise:

  • PayPal requires prior deposit linkage. If you funded via debit card but try withdrawing to PayPal, it fails.
  • ACH needs exact bank name match. “Chase Bank” vs. “JPMorgan Chase” = rejection.
  • Play+ has hidden reload fees after the first free withdrawal per month.

The State-by-State Wildcard: Where Geography Blocks Cashouts

FanDuel’s withdrawal rules shift based on your location—not just legality, but regulatory interpretation. For example:

  • New Jersey: Requires SSN re-verification for withdrawals over $5,000.
  • Arizona: Blocks PayPal entirely for iGaming (sports betting OK).
  • Pennsylvania: Mandates 72-hour “cooling-off” period after large wins (>10x deposit).
  • Virginia: Disallows check withdrawals; digital only.

If you travel while logged in, geolocation checks may flag your account. Withdrawal requests from a neighboring state—even with valid residency—trigger manual review. Resolution? Often requires calling support with utility bills proving home address.

Always confirm your state’s current policy via FanDuel’s footer link “Licensed Jurisdictions.” Don’t rely on third-party summaries—they lag behind regulatory updates.

Step-by-Step Fix: How to Unlock Your Withdrawal Today

If FanDuel isn’t letting you withdraw, follow this sequence—in order:

  1. Check “Withdrawal Status” in Account > History
    Look for red banners like “Verification Required” or “Bonus Terms Pending.”

  2. Re-upload ID with these specs:

  3. Color copy of government-issued photo ID (driver’s license, passport)
  4. Document must show expiration date (non-expired)
  5. File format: JPG or PNG under 10MB
  6. No glare, shadows, or cropped edges

  7. Confirm payment method matches deposit source
    If you used a Visa card ending in 1234, withdraw only to that exact card.

  8. Clear bonus requirements
    Go to “Promotions” > “Active Bonuses” and verify playthrough progress. Bet real money—not bonus funds—to clear faster.

  9. Contact live chat during peak U.S. hours
    Best response window: 10 AM – 6 PM ET, Monday–Friday. Avoid weekends.

Pro Tip: Say “I need help with a withdrawal hold due to KYC” — not “Why can’t I cash out?” Specific phrasing routes you to Tier 2 support faster.

When to Escalate: Regulatory Bodies That Actually Respond

If FanDuel ignores your request beyond 72 hours post-verification, file a formal complaint. In the U.S., each licensed state has a gaming control board with enforcement power:

  • New Jersey: Division of Gaming Enforcement
  • Michigan: Michigan Gaming Control Board
  • Colorado: Division of Gaming

Include:
- Screenshot of withdrawal attempt
- Timestamped ID upload confirmation
- Support ticket number (if any)

Most state boards resolve cases within 10 business days. FanDuel typically releases funds within 24 hours of receiving the inquiry.

Do not contact the FTC or BBB first—they defer to state regulators for licensed operators.

Why does FanDuel say “insufficient funds” when I have a balance?

Your visible balance includes non-withdrawable bonus cash. Only “Cash Balance” (not “Bonus Balance”) can be withdrawn. Check your account summary for the split.

Can I withdraw winnings from a free bet?

No. Free bet stakes are never returned. Only net winnings (profit) are added to your cash balance—and even then, only after meeting any associated playthrough requirements.

How long does FanDuel take to approve ID documents?

Officially 24–72 hours, but weekends/holidays extend this. If submitted on Thursday, expect approval by Tuesday. Expired or blurry documents reset the clock.

Does FanDuel charge withdrawal fees?

Play+, PayPal, and ACH are free. Checks cost $2.50. However, failed withdrawal attempts due to user error may incur processing delays but no direct fees.

Can I change my withdrawal method after submitting a request?

No. Once submitted, you must cancel the request (if still pending) and create a new one with the correct method. Cancellation can take up to 24 hours.

What if I deposited with a prepaid card?

FanDuel prohibits withdrawals to most prepaid cards (including Vanilla, Green Dot). You’ll need to use Play+, PayPal, or ACH instead—even if the prepaid card was your deposit method.
